The cost of repairing an exhaust leak defies a one-size-fits-all answer because the exhaust system is a modular puzzle. A leak in the tailpipe is one thing; a fractured exhaust manifold near the engine is another. Even the type of vehicle plays a role: a muscle car’s straight-pipe exhaust might require custom fabrication, while a mass-market sedan could use off-the-shelf parts. Labor rates vary by region—$90–$150/hour in urban areas vs. $60–$100 in rural shops—while parts prices fluctuate based on brand, material (stainless steel vs. mild steel), and whether the component is OEM or aftermarket.

Most drivers underestimate the hidden costs. For example, a $300 repair estimate might not account for:

  • Diagnostic fees ($80–$150) to pinpoint the exact leak source.
  • Additional labor if the mechanic discovers corrosion or misaligned components.
  • Warranty voids if aftermarket parts are used without proper certification.
  • Environmental regulations in some states that mandate emissions-compliant repairs.
The average exhaust repair ranges from $150 for a minor patch to $1,500+ for a full system replacement, but the true expense often hinges on whether the leak is addressed early or ignored until it becomes a systemic failure.

Core Mechanisms: How It Works

An exhaust leak occurs when gases escape from the system before reaching the tailpipe. The most common failure points are:

  • Gaskets and seals: These degrade over time due to heat and vibration, creating gaps that allow exhaust fumes to seep.
  • Welded joints: Poor-quality welds or stress fractures in pipes can split under pressure.
  • Catalytic converters: Internal clogging or physical damage (e.g., from road debris) forces gases to find alternate paths.
  • Mufflers: Rust or impact damage weakens the structure, leading to holes or collapses.
The leak’s location dictates the repair difficulty. For instance, a leak near the exhaust manifold requires engine removal or careful maneuvering to access, while a tailpipe leak is straightforward. The severity also matters: a small hole may only need a clamp or sealant, but a fractured manifold could necessitate a full replacement.

Diagnosing the exact source is critical. Mechanics use smoke machines (injecting harmless smoke into the exhaust to visualize leaks) or infrared cameras to detect heat loss. A check engine light often accompanies leaks, but not always—some leaks are silent until they cause noticeable performance drops, like a rough idle or reduced horsepower. The key is acting before the leak propagates, as exhaust gases contain unburned fuel that can damage the catalytic converter or oxygen sensors, further inflating repair costs.

Comparative Analysis

The cost of fixing an exhaust leak varies widely based on the repair type. Below is a breakdown of common scenarios:

Repair Type Estimated Cost Range
Minor Patch (Clamp/Sealant) $50–$200 (labor + parts)
Muffler Replacement $200–$800 (OEM vs. aftermarket)
Exhaust Pipe Replacement $150–$600 (per section, depending on material)
Catalytic Converter Replacement $1,000–$2,500+ (OEM vs. universal)

Note: Labor costs can add 50–100% to the parts price, especially for complex repairs like manifold replacements. DIY repairs (e.g., applying exhaust sealant) may save money but risk voiding warranties or causing further damage.

Q: Can I fix a small exhaust leak myself, or should I take it to a professional?

A: Minor leaks (e.g., a small hole in the tailpipe) can be temporarily patched with exhaust sealant or a clamp, but these are short-term fixes. For leaks near the engine or catalytic converter, professional welding is required to ensure a proper seal. DIY repairs risk voiding warranties or causing further damage if not done correctly.

Q: Why does my car’s exhaust leak cost more in some shops than others?

A: Pricing varies due to labor rates, parts quality, and overhead costs. Dealerships often charge more for OEM parts and certified labor, while independent shops may offer discounts on aftermarket components. Always get multiple quotes and ask about warranties on parts and labor.

Q: Will fixing an exhaust leak improve my car’s fuel economy?

A: Yes. A leaking exhaust disrupts the engine’s air-fuel ratio, causing unburned fuel to escape. Sealing the leak restores proper combustion, which can improve fuel efficiency by 10–30% in severe cases. However, if the catalytic converter or oxygen sensors are damaged, additional repairs may be needed for full efficiency.

Q: How long does an exhaust repair typically take?

A: Minor repairs (e.g., clamp or sealant) take 30–60 minutes. Muffler or pipe replacements usually require 1–3 hours, while catalytic converter or manifold repairs can take 3–6 hours or more, depending on engine access. Always confirm the estimated time with your mechanic.

Q: Does my car’s warranty cover exhaust leak repairs?

A: It depends on the cause. If the leak is due to manufacturer defects (e.g., faulty gaskets or materials), the warranty may cover it. However, leaks caused by rust, accidents, or lack of maintenance are typically not covered. Check your warranty terms or contact the dealer for clarification.

Q: Can a leaking exhaust cause my catalytic converter to fail?

A: Absolutely. Exhaust leaks allow unburned fuel and gases to bypass the catalytic converter, overheating it and causing clogging or physical damage. A failed converter is one of the most expensive exhaust-related repairs, costing $1,000–$2,500 to replace. Addressing leaks promptly can prevent this.

Q: Are aftermarket exhaust parts as reliable as OEM?

A: Aftermarket parts can be reliable, especially from reputable brands, but they may not meet the same durability or emissions standards as OEM components. Cheap aftermarket parts risk premature failure or voiding warranties. Always choose certified aftermarket brands if you opt for non-OEM repairs.

Q: How often should I inspect my exhaust system for leaks?

A: At minimum, inspect your exhaust system twice a year—before long road trips and during routine maintenance. Listen for unusual noises, check for rust or holes, and ensure all bolts and clamps are secure. If you drive in snowy or salty climates, inspect more frequently, as corrosion accelerates in these conditions.
